4 Wheel Folding Mobility Scooter

The transporting of a folding mobility scooter is easy. It is easy to fold it up and place it in the trunk of a vehicle to take it wherever you want to go.

When folded, these models are incredibly small and can be easily tucked away in the trunk of a small vehicle. They also have a nimble turning radius and are ideal for indoor use.

Comfortable Seat

A good folding scooter will have a very comfortable, adjustable height swivel seat and armrests that are cushioned. Some have a large plastic carrying basket for convenience. If you'll be using the scooter mostly outdoors, you should consider a model with suspension to reduce the bumps and vibrations of rough surfaces.

Some models will fold into a compact shape, making them small enough to fit into the trunk of your car or a closet at home. Others will have a remote control to allow you to fold them and some will even have an automatic folding feature which can be activated by pressing the button. These types of scooters tend to be more expensive than standard models, but they're worth the extra money for those who need something that's more portable and easy to travel with.

Simple to operate

A four-wheel mobility scooter that folds is a great option when you're looking for a scooter to help you get around but have difficulty lifting or turning heavy items. They are lighter than other kinds of scooters, and they fold easily into your car or in the closet at home. They still require some lifting strength but they're much easier to maneuver and offer a more comfortable ride in mountainous terrains or in rough terrains.

Check the handlebar height to ensure that it is at the right level for you. Also, look for a tiller that's adjustable to allow you to adjust it in your preferred driving position, reducing strain on your wrists and arms. The comfort can be further improved by a comfortable backrest and seat. You should also consider a battery indicator so that you are aware of when to recharge the scooter.

When selecting a scooter, it's important to know whether the scooter can be used with both public and private transportation. It's essential that the scooter can be easily folded down or unfolded in order to transfer it to trains, buses, or taxis. Also, it should be easy to fit into the trunk or backseat of your own car. This is true, especially when you plan to take the scooter to a vacation spot.

Make sure that the battery in your scooter is airline-approved. If you plan on traveling frequently on your scooter it is essential to have this. Airlines have strict regulations regarding the kind and size of batteries permitted on board. Some manufacturers offer several different sizes of batteries so that you can select one that best suits your needs for travel.

Choose a scooter with an automatic braking feature. This is a fantastic safety feature that will stop the scooter from rolling away when you're driving, or parked on the side of the road. The majority of scooters have a button on the tiller to activate this feature, but some automatically activate it when you let go of the accelerator.

Easy to Fold

A folding scooter is a great option for people who want to travel. It is able to easily fit into the trunk of a car or be put away in the closet of your home. Additionally, it typically weighs less than a conventional mobility scooter. This makes it easier for someone to lift on their own, or for family members to help them with.

A folding scooter can be great for short trips, but it is not the best option for long distances or on rough terrain. They can feel shaky on rough roads and sidewalks because they don't have enough suspension. If you're looking for a folding scooter with bigger suspension or wheels it will be much easier to ride on rough surfaces.

Easy to transport

The majority of folding mobility scooters can be folded into smaller sections, making it easier to put them in the trunk of your car or to take them on public transportation. The manual will contain specific instructions for each type of scooter. Certain scooters have handles or wheels to facilitate transport. Take into consideration the battery range if you intend to travel for long distances on your scooter.

Three-wheel scooters have a small turning radius, making them ideal for use indoors. They are also great for narrow aisles and hallways. Their design could cause them to be unstable when traveling over rough surfaces or uphill.

However, four-wheel scooters offer greater stability and balance over their three-wheeled counterparts. They also have a larger base that can accommodate larger seats and can withstand more weight.

If you plan on using your folding mobility scooter for trips abroad, be sure to verify that it is airport-friendly. Some models of this type come equipped with airplane-safe batteries, meaning that you can take it with you on flights and cruises without worrying about any restrictions or extra costs.
